+=head1 NAME
+
+SL::DBConnect - Connect to database for configured client/user,
+optionally routing through DBIx::Log4perl
+
+=head1 SYNOPSIS
+
+ # Connect to default database of current user/client, disabling auto
+ # commit mode:
+ my @options_suitable_for_dbi_connect =
+ SL::DBConnect->get_connect_args(AutoCommit => 0);
+ my $dbh = SL::DBConnect->connect(@options_suitable_for_dbi_connect);
+
+ # Connect to a very specific database:
+ my $dbh = SL::DBConnect->connect('dbi:Pg:dbname=demo', 'user', 'password');
